Five Things to Know Today, Sept. 9, in Montgomery County

It’s Wednesday, Sept. 9, and here are five things to know in Montgomery County:

1. Trash Collection: Tuesday’s recycling and trash pick-up will be done today due to Labor Day. Get those bins to the curb before it’s too late!

2. Free COVID-19 Testing: Montgomery County’s free coronavirus testing clinic runs from 9 a.m. to 1 p.m. at the Wheaton Library and Community Recreation Center and the CDC Mobile Trailer at Lakeforest Mall.

3. Food Assistance: Montgomery County reminds those who need food assistance to call 311. Montgomery County Public Schools (MCPS) began distributing free meals to students again on Tuesday.

4. Climate Discussion: The Montgomery County Climate Mobilization group will hold a virtual discussion at 7:30 p.m. called “Why Resilience Matters” to address climate change in the county.
